The PARK function in an automatic transmission is indicated by the letter “ P “. The transmission gears are locked when the gear shifter is in park, preventing the wheels from spinning forward or backward. The park or P mode physically locks the transmission, preventing the car from moving in any direction.

WebBevel gears are most commonly used to transmit power between shafts that intersect at a 90 degree angle. They are used in applications where a right angle gear drive is required. This is usually supplemented by a fourth gear for added strength, completing the square. philosophy\\u0027s 74Web30 mei 2024 · 5th, or 6th gear (if you car has it) are termed as ‘overdrive’ gears. An overdrive gear allows your car to cruise at a high speed while maintaining low engine revolutions. You’ll use 5th or 6th gear for highway cruising at speeds of 60 mph to 70 mph and are ideal gears for best fuel economy. t shirt red bull f1 2017Web11 feb. 2024 · Why Do Electric Cars Only Have One Gear?
